本文目录导读:
《黑莓设备中“无法枚举容器中的对象,访问被拒绝”及应用安全信息时错误的深度解析与解决之道》
在黑莓设备的使用过程中,遇到“无法枚举容器中的对象,访问被拒绝”这样的错误提示,同时涉及应用安全信息时出错,是一件相当棘手的事情,这不仅影响用户正常使用设备中的各项功能,还可能涉及到数据安全与隐私保护等多方面的隐患。
错误现象剖析
1、访问机制受阻
- 在黑莓的系统架构中,容器是用于存储各种数据对象的重要结构,例如应用程序数据、用户配置文件等,当出现“无法枚举容器中的对象,访问被拒绝”的错误时,意味着系统在尝试访问这些容器内的对象时,遭到了权限方面的限制,这种权限限制可能是由于多种原因造成的,可能是应用程序自身的权限设置出现了问题,某个应用在安装或者更新后,其请求的访问容器对象的权限没有被正确地授予或者被意外地收回,系统级别的安全策略调整也可能导致这种情况,黑莓以其高度安全的特性闻名,当系统检测到可能存在的安全威胁时,会收紧权限控制,这可能会误判某些正常的访问请求。
2、应用安全信息关联
- 应用安全信息在黑莓系统中起着至关重要的作用,它涵盖了应用的来源验证、数据加密方式、与系统资源交互的权限等多方面内容,当在应用安全信息方面出现错误时,很可能与上述访问容器对象被拒的情况相互关联,如果应用的安全证书出现问题,如证书过期或者被篡改,系统可能会限制该应用对容器对象的访问,这是因为系统无法确定该应用是否具有合法的身份来获取这些敏感数据,应用在更新过程中如果安全配置文件没有正确迁移,也可能导致其在访问容器对象时被拒绝,因为系统可能认为该应用的安全状态不符合要求。
可能的原因探寻
1、软件更新问题
- 黑莓系统或者应用的更新是为了修复漏洞、提升性能和增加新功能,更新过程并不总是一帆风顺,在更新过程中,可能会出现文件损坏的情况,在下载更新包时,如果网络不稳定,可能会导致部分文件丢失或者损坏,当这些损坏的文件涉及到权限管理或者容器对象访问相关的模块时,就可能引发“无法枚举容器中的对象,访问被拒绝”的错误,更新后的版本可能与旧版本的安全策略存在兼容性问题,导致应用安全信息无法正确匹配系统的要求,从而出现错误。
2、安全策略冲突
- 黑莓的安全策略是多层次的,包括设备级别的安全策略、企业级(如果设备应用于企业环境)的安全策略以及应用自身的安全策略,这些策略之间可能会发生冲突,企业可能通过移动设备管理(MDM)系统对设备设置了严格的安全策略,限制了某些应用对容器对象的访问,而这些应用在开发时可能按照不同的安全标准进行设计,当设备处于企业管理之下时,就会出现访问被拒的情况,系统自身的默认安全策略在某些特殊情况下也可能与应用的安全需求产生矛盾。
3、恶意软件或安全威胁
- 尽管黑莓系统具有较高的安全性,但仍然不能完全排除恶意软件的威胁,如果设备感染了恶意软件,这种恶意软件可能会篡改系统的权限设置或者干扰应用安全信息的正常运行,恶意软件可能会伪装成合法的应用,试图获取容器对象中的敏感数据,为了防止这种情况,系统可能会触发严格的权限限制,导致正常的应用也无法枚举容器中的对象,出现访问被拒的情况。
解决策略
1、系统与应用更新检查
- 首先要确保黑莓系统和相关应用都是最新版本,对于系统更新,可以在设备的设置选项中查找系统更新选项,重新下载并安装更新,确保下载过程中网络稳定,对于应用更新,可以前往应用商店,查看是否有可用的更新版本,如果更新过程中出现错误,可以尝试清除应用的缓存和数据后再次更新,这有助于修复可能存在的文件损坏问题,使应用能够正确获取访问容器对象的权限,同时确保应用安全信息与系统的兼容性。
2、安全策略调整
- 如果设备处于企业环境下,需要与企业的IT部门联系,沟通安全策略相关的问题,他们可以检查企业级的安全策略是否过于严格,是否存在误判应用访问权限的情况,对于系统自身的安全策略,可以在设备的安全设置选项中进行适当的调整,但需要谨慎操作,避免降低设备的整体安全性,可以检查应用权限设置,确保应用具有合理的访问容器对象的权限。
3、安全扫描与防护
- 运行全面的安全扫描来检测设备是否存在恶意软件,黑莓设备通常自带安全扫描工具,可以利用这些工具进行深度扫描,如果发现恶意软件,按照系统提示进行清除操作,可以考虑安装可靠的第三方安全防护软件,进一步增强设备的安全性,在清除恶意软件后,重新检查应用对容器对象的访问情况,看是否能够正常枚举对象,解决访问被拒的问题。
黑莓设备中“无法枚举容器中的对象,访问被拒绝”以及应用安全信息时错误是一个复杂的问题,需要从多个方面进行分析和解决,通过深入了解黑莓的系统架构、安全策略以及应用运行机制,我们可以采取有效的措施来恢复设备的正常功能,确保数据的安全与正常访问。
评论列表